#include <dali-toolkit/dali-toolkit.h>
#include <dali/devel-api/adaptor-framework/tilt-sensor.h>

using namespace Dali;
using Dali::Toolkit::TextLabel;

// This example shows how to use sensor using a simple TextLabel
//
class TiltController : public ConnectionTracker
{
public:
  TiltController(Application& application)
  : mApplication(application)
  {
    // Connect to the Application's Init signal
    mApplication.InitSignal().Connect(this, &TiltController::Create);
  }

  ~TiltController()
  {
    // Nothing to do here;
  }

  // The Init signal is received once (only) during the Application lifetime
  void Create(Application& application)
  {
    // Get a handle to the window
    Window window = application.GetWindow();
    window.SetBackgroundColor(Color::BLUE);

    mTextLabel = TextLabel::New("Tilt Sensor Demo");
    mTextLabel.SetProperty(Actor::Property::PARENT_ORIGIN, ParentOrigin::CENTER);
    mTextLabel.SetProperty(Actor::Property::ANCHOR_POINT, AnchorPoint::CENTER);
    mTextLabel.SetProperty(TextLabel::Property::HORIZONTAL_ALIGNMENT, "CENTER");
    mTextLabel.SetProperty(TextLabel::Property::VERTICAL_ALIGNMENT, "CENTER");
    mTextLabel.SetProperty(TextLabel::Property::TEXT_COLOR, Color::WHITE);
    mTextLabel.SetProperty(TextLabel::Property::POINT_SIZE, 15.0f);
    mTextLabel.SetProperty(Dali::Actor::Property::NAME, "tiltLabel");
    window.Add(mTextLabel);

    // Respond to a click anywhere on the window
    window.GetRootLayer().TouchedSignal().Connect(this, &TiltController::OnTouch);

    CreateSensor();

    // Connect signals to allow Back and Escape to exit.
    window.KeyEventSignal().Connect(this, &TiltController::OnKeyEvent);
  }

  void CreateSensor()
  {
    mTiltSensor = TiltSensor::Get();
    if(mTiltSensor.Start())
    {
      // Get notifications when the device is tilted
      mTiltSensor.TiltedSignal().Connect(this, &TiltController::OnTilted);
    }
  }

  bool OnTouch(Actor actor, const TouchEvent& touch)
  {
    // quit the application
    mApplication.Quit();
    return true;
  }

  void OnTilted(const TiltSensor& sensor)
  {
    Quaternion pitchRot(Radian(Degree(sensor.GetPitch() * 90.0f)), Vector3(1, 0, 0));
    Quaternion rollRot(Radian(Degree(sensor.GetRoll() * 90.0f)), Vector3(0, 1, 0));

    mTextLabel.SetProperty(Actor::Property::ORIENTATION, Quaternion());
    mTextLabel.RotateBy(rollRot);
    mTextLabel.RotateBy(pitchRot);
    ;
  }

  /**
   * @brief OnKeyEvent signal handler.
   * @param[in] event The key event information
   */
  void OnKeyEvent(const KeyEvent& event)
  {
    if(event.GetState() == KeyEvent::DOWN)
    {
      if(IsKey(event, Dali::DALI_KEY_ESCAPE) || IsKey(event, Dali::DALI_KEY_BACK))
      {
        mApplication.Quit();
      }
    }
  }

private:
  Application& mApplication;
  TiltSensor   mTiltSensor;
  TextLabel    mTextLabel;
};

int DALI_EXPORT_API main(int argc, char** argv)
{
  Application    application = Application::New(&argc, &argv);
  TiltController test(application);

  application.MainLoop();
  return 0;
}
